On Sat, Mar 26, 2022 at 09:59:52PM +0100, Fabian wrote: > I think I might have found the problem, but unsure on how to fix that. > In the room there is a fluorescent lamp, whenever someone switches on the > light, there is a chance the PPS input on the card will stop. How long is the cable and is it electrically terminated? I have seen the PPS timestamping on I210 to randomly stop working when reconnecting between different GPS units. I suspect it happens when the hardware gets multiple pulses too close to each other. I can reproduce it by configuring the GPS with the CFG-TP5 command to generate pulses at a very high rate. There seem to be two different failure modes. With one it is sufficient to restart chronyd, but the other one requires reloading of the driver.
